About 4-methoxy-6-(trifluoromethyl)pyrimidine

4-methoxy-6-(trifluoromethyl)pyrimidine (PubChem CID 18953277) has the molecular formula C6H5F3N2O and a molecular weight of 178.11 g/mol. Its IUPAC name is 4-methoxy-6-(trifluoromethyl)pyrimidine.
